Welcome to Physical science!
Typically taken in the freshman year, this class explores both a little chemistry and a lot of physics.
You can expect to learn about the periodic table, the complexity of electrons, and how molecules bond all within the first 9 weeks of school!
From there, we spend the rest of the year studying the mathematical physics of motion, waves, and electromagnetics. Physics is a fairly math heavy subject and I definitely reccomend having a calculator for this class. Other useful items include a 3-ring binder, looseleaf paper, writing utensils and colored pencils.
